Understanding Erectile Dysfunction
Erectile Dysfunction (ED) is defined as the persistent inability to attain or maintain an erection sufficient for satisfactory sexual performance. It is a common medical condition affecting tens of millions of men globally, with prevalence increasing with age.
Causes & Risk Factors
Erectile function relies on a complex interplay of vascular, neurological, hormonal, and psychological factors. ED is frequently an early marker for systemic cardiovascular disease. Some of the causes and risk factors include:
- Vascular: Atherosclerosis, hypertension, hyperlipidemia, and diabetes mellitus impair penile arterial inflow and venous outflow.
- Neurological: Parkinson’s disease, multiple sclerosis, spinal cord injury, or nerve injury following pelvic surgery (e.g., radical prostatectomy).
- Hormonal: Hypogonadism (Low T), hyperprolactinemia, or thyroid dysfunction.
- Lifestyle & Psychogenic: Smoking, obesity, sedentary lifestyle, stress, performance anxiety, and depression.
Diagnostic Evaluation
A comprehensive clinical workup helps identifies underlying etiology and directs targeted therapy:
- Medical & Sexual History: Utilizing validated instruments such as the International Index of Erectile Function (IIEF).
- Laboratory Testing: Morning total testosterone, fasting glucose/HbA1c, lipid panel, and serum creatinine.
- Diagnostic Imaging: Penile Duplex Doppler Ultrasound (PDDU) following intracavernosal injection to evaluate arterial inflow and venous leak.
Treatment Modalities
Treatment follows a stepped-care approach tailored to patient preferences and severity:
| Level | Treatment | Mechanism / Description |
| First-Line | Oral PDE5 Inhibitors | Sildenafil, Tadalafil, Vardenafil, and Avanafil |
| Lifestyle Modifications | Weight loss, cardiovascular exercise, smoking cessation, and glycemic control. | |
| Second-Line | Intracavernosal Injections (ICI) | Compounded vasoactive medications (Alprostadil, Bimix, Trimix) injected directly into the corpora cavernosa. |
| Vacuum Erection Devices (VED) | Mechanical negative pressure devices that draw blood into the penis, held by a constriction ring. | |
| Third-Line | Inflatable Penile Prosthesis (IPP) | Surgical placement of a three-piece hydraulic implant offering a definitive, permanent solution. |
Peyronie’s Disease
Peyronie’s Disease (PD) is an acquired connective tissue disorder of the penis characterized by the formation of collagen plaques within the tunica albuginea. This leads to penile curvature, shortening, pain, and erectile deformity.
Disease Phases
Peyronie’s disease progresses through two distinct clinical phases:
- Acute (Inflammatory) Phase: Typically lasts 6 to 12 months. Characterized by active plaque formation, painful erections, and evolving penile curvature.
- Chronic (Stable) Phase: Pain generally resolves, and the degree of curvature and plaque calcification stabilizes for at least 3 months.
Treatment Options
Therapeutic intervention depends on the phase and degree of functional impairment:
- Conservative Management: Penile traction therapy (PTT) and oral vacuum devices used during early phases to mitigate length loss and curvature progression.
- Intralesional Injections: Collagenase Clostridium histolyticum (CCH) or interferon alpha-2b injected directly into stable plaques combined with mechanical modeling to disrupt fibrous tissue.
- Surgical Reconstruction (For Chronic, Stable Disease):
-
- Tunica Albuginea Plication: For patients with adequate erectile function and mild/moderate curvature (<60°); shortens the longer (convex) side.
- Plaque Excision/Incision & Grafting: For severe curvature or complex hour-glass deformities in men with intact erectile function.
- Penile Prosthesis Placement: For men with coexisting severe ED and Peyronie’s disease, combined with manual modeling or plication.

Low Testosterone
Testosterone deficiency is a clinical syndrome resulting from failure of the testes to produce physiological levels of testosterone. It affects energy, metabolic function, bone density, and sexual health.
Classification & Etiology
- Primary Hypogonadism (Testicular Failure): Low testosterone with elevated gonadotropins (LH and FSH). Causes include genetic conditions like Klinefelter syndrome, orchitis, testicular trauma, or chemotherapy.
- Secondary Hypogonadism (Hypothalamic/Pituitary Dysfunction): Low testosterone with low or inappropriately normal LH/FSH. Causes include pituitary adenomas, hyperprolactinemia, severe obesity, type 2 diabetes, HIV/AIDS or chronic opioid/corticosteroid use.
Diagnostic Criteria
Diagnosis requires both clinical symptoms and laboratory confirmation:
- Symptom Profile: Low libido, fatigue, decreased lean muscle mass, increased body fat, erectile dysfunction, depressive mood, and reduced bone mineral density.
- Biochemical Testing: At least two separate early-morning (8:00 AM – 10:00 AM) fasting serum total testosterone measurements below 300 ng/dL, supplemented by free testosterone testing if SHBG abnormalities are suspected.
Testosterone Replacement Therapy (TRT) & Alternatives
TRT aims to restore serum testosterone to the mid-normal physiological range (400–700 ng/dL). It’s important to consider a therapy based on plans for fertility. Make sure to discuss this with your provider.
Types of testoterone supplementation include:
- Intramuscular/Subcutaneous Injections: Testosterone Cypionate or Enanthate administered weekly or bi-weekly.
- Transdermal Formulations: Daily gels or solution applications maintaining stable daily hormone levels.
- Oral pills: Daily pills of testosterone taken at various doses to achieve steady state.
- Subdermal Pellets: Long-acting pellets implanted subcutaneously every 3 to 6 months.
- Fertility-Preserving Therapies: Human Chorionic Gonadotropin (hCG) or Selective Estrogen Receptor Modulators (SERMs like enclomiphene) to stimulate endogenous production without suppressing spermatogenesis.
